Форум » Pascal/Delphi » помогите с ошибками » Ответить

помогите с ошибками

iamhated: {Даны две последовательности чисел a1, a2, ..., an и b1, b2, ..., bn. Сформируйте новые последовательности, элементы которых вычисляются по следующему правилу: ai = max(ai, bi), bi = min(ai, bi), i = 1, 2, ..., n.} unit unit8_18; interface procedure vved(var fin:text, var m:integer; var a:mas; filename:string); procedure vived(var fout:text, m:integer, a:mas, filename:string); function max(a:integer; b:integer); function min(a:integer; b:integer); implementation procedure vved(var fin:text;var m:integer; var a:mas; filename:string); var i:integer; begin assign(fin,filename); reset(fin); read(fin,m); for i:=1 to m do read(fin,a); close(fin); end; procedure vived(var fout:text;m:integer; a:mas; filename:string); var i:integer; begin assign(fout,filename); rewrite(fout); for i:=1 to m do write(fout,a:5); writeln(fout); end; close(fout); end; function max(a: integer; b: integer):integer; begin if (a > b) then max := a else max := b; end; function min(a: integer; b: integer): integer; begin if (a < b) then min := a else min := b; end; end. program l8_18; uses crt, unit8_18; const n=10; var a:array[1..n] of integer; b:array[1..n] of integer; i,m:integer; begin clrscr; vved(f,m,a,'l8_18in.txt'); min(a,b); max(a,b); vived(g,m,a,'l8_18out.txt'); readkey; end.

Ответов - 0



полная версия страницы